About Postman
Postman is the platform that became the standard way developers work with APIs. APIs are the connective tissue of modern software — the way applications talk to each other — and Postman provides a comprehensive environment for building, testing, documenting, and collaborating on them. What started as a simple tool for sending requests to an API and inspecting the responses has grown into a full API development platform used by millions of developers and a huge share of the world's software teams, becoming an indispensable part of how APIs get made and maintained.
At its core, Postman lets you construct and send requests to any API and examine exactly what comes back, which makes exploring, debugging, and understanding an API far easier than doing it through raw code. From there it expands into the whole API lifecycle: you can organise requests into collections, write automated tests that verify an API behaves correctly, manage different environments (development, staging, production), generate and host clear documentation, mock APIs before they're built, and monitor them over time. Crucially, Postman is built for collaboration — teams share collections and environments so everyone works from the same definitions, which keeps an organisation's understanding of its APIs consistent. It supports modern API standards and integrates into development workflows and CI pipelines.
Postman is used by backend and frontend developers, QA engineers, and increasingly anyone who needs to work with APIs, from solo developers to the largest enterprises. Its value is that it makes the often invisible, fiddly work of API development tangible, organised, and shareable. Instead of testing APIs with ad-hoc scripts and scattered notes, teams get a single, powerful home for their API work that improves quality and speeds up development. For virtually any project that builds or consumes APIs — which is to say, most modern software — Postman has become an essential tool, the place developers naturally turn whenever they need to understand, test, or document how their systems communicate.
